Do Not Delay Collecting Evidence
One of the biggest mistakes employees make is waiting too long before gathering evidence. Save emails, text messages, performance reviews, witness details, and any written communication related to the discrimination. Strong documentation gives your Employment discrimination lawyer valuable information to build a convincing case. Avoid Ignoring Legal Deadlines
Employment discrimination claims are subject to strict filing deadlines, and missing them can prevent your case from moving forward. Many individuals assume they have unlimited time, only to discover that legal time limits have expired. An experienced Employment discrimination lawyer can explain the applicable deadlines and ensure that all required documents are submitted correctly. Seeking legal advice early also helps you understand whether negotiation, mediation, or a formal complaint is the best course of action.
Never Hide Important Information from Your Lawyer
Honesty is essential when working with your legal representative. Some clients leave out details because they think certain facts may hurt their case, but incomplete information can create unexpected challenges later. Your Employment discrimination lawyer needs a complete understanding of the situation to prepare the strongest legal strategy.
